Default Alternator Dead

a few weeks back i let you all know that i have an issue with my exterior temp sensor being bad and my battery dieing (sp?) after only a half an hour of 'acc' radio listening. Well, i went to Wally'* World and had them check the battery - it was fine and they deep cell checked and charged it. Every was ok until

Yesterday when i was changing my front brakes out, a one hour job - at most. Of course i had the radio playing for some background noise. i have had the trunk box disconnected thinking that there was a drain being caused by the power required, but when i went to start the car to go get my poly endlinks from Auto Zone she just "clicked" at me!

one hour of stock radio and the darn battery is drained again, just Great! So, i bust out the good ol' plug in battery charger and wait an hour. Start her up and drive to Auto Zone to get my charging system checked ... Well the manager tells me that they only have two people on duty so they can't do the intitial parking lot check. :? Now i have to pull the alternator (which was a suggestion on here by Rogue - i believe - because of all my electrical gremlins) in the parking lot. i get to work on that...

*** side note: does anyone else hate the way their knees feel after leaning over a car? the pressure on my knees is annoying when i am leaning in over the fender and then trying to standup and walk is just down right painful. end side note****

... and get the alternator out and take it in the store for the bench test. Did you all know that the 00 alternators are $194 OUCH!
anyway the test showed that the regulator was bad. good thing is i have <4000 miles left on my extended warranty so, they will be seeing me this week for my alternator, exterior temp sensor and that steering position sensor that everyone is saying caused their 'service stability system' warnings.

oh yeah, the ceramics pads are on (duralast golds - lifetime warranty from Auto Zone - i think they were $39.99 ) and i picked up the sway bar end links for both the front and back (also, from Auto Zone - Energy Suspension #9.8120R $15.99). Did you all know that the front and rear endlinks are the same? i thought that was odd - but in a good way.

also, i have been experiencing a surging at 1500 to 2K rpm. not too sure what that is all about... could it be related to the alternator? or maybe i need to change my fuel filter ( i last changed that at the day before IDD last year), i may have the dealer look at that also.

I would like to know how Auto Zone checked your alternator on an SSEi in the store. They had to check mine on the car because they didn't have a test reference for the SC motor, and neither did Advance Auto. The NA alternator could be checked, but they couldn't check the SC version. Every store I've been to has been like this also.

Originally Posted by Xac Xado
don't know, but he looked up the alternator on the computer, wrote down the numbers, and put it on the test station.

i find it odd that the n/a would have a different alternator.
There are 2 different part #'* but look like the same mounting points.
With sc #10464440
Without sc #10464439
